The withdrawal of soviet combatant forces from the afghanistan began on 15 may 1988 and successfully executed on 15 february 1989 under the leadership of colonelgeneral boris gromov who also was the last soviet general officer to walk from afghanistan back into soviet territory through the afghanuzbek bridge.
